This week, the gardeners are chatting about our indoor companions and how we can prepare them for the colder months ahead. Lighting, watering, repotting, fertilizing —these factors can make all the difference between a thriving plant and one that's merely surviving. If you're a beginner, we'll highlight some forgiving, and not so forgiving, options that will set yourself up for success. If you've been caring for houseplants outside over the summer, what should you watch for when you bring them in? Is autumn a good time to start propagating houseplants?
